It lacks only a dc power jack and is instead powered through the minib usb connector. The device is manufactured using atmels high density nonvolatile memory technology. We can put a time delay on a self destruct in our evil lair, we. Dell emc unity xt hybrid storage arrays start in a sleek 2u form factor with a modern architecture designed to take full advantage of flash technology deployed in a hybrid or allflash storage pool for the best performance with the economics of disk. Atmega48, atmega88, and atmega168 the atmega48, atmega88 and atmega168 differ only in memory sizes, boot loader support, and interrupt vector sizes. Atmega16820au microchip technology atmel mouser india. They are available as modules in the cduino system, so building and uploading them should be pretty easy. Avr is a family of microcontrollers developed since 1996 by atmel, acquired by microchip technology in 2016. Arduino pro mini is of two types they are differentiated based on controller. Back in year we start to design different development. Fortunately for us electronics guys our parts are tiny so storage isnt a problem. Atmega16820pu microchip technology atmel 8bit microcontrollers mcu 16kb flash 0. Compare pricing for atmel atmega168 20ai across 2 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art.
Atmega168 datasheet, atmega168 datasheets, atmega168 pdf, atmega168 circuit. Atstk600 kit atstk600 a complete starter kit and development system for the 8bit and 32bit avr microcontrollers that gives designers a quick start to develop code on the avr, with advanced features for prototyping and testing new designs. Arduino pro mini board is one of application boards. Atmega168 datasheet, atmega168 pdf, atmega168 data sheet, atmega168 manual, atmega168 pdf, atmega168, datenblatt, electronics atmega168, alldatasheet, free, datasheet. Easily provision and rebalance workloads by monitoring clusters and nodes. Using serial peripheral interface spi master and slave with atmel avr microcontroller. Recent listings manufacturer directory get instant. Compare pricing for atmel atmega168 20ai across 4 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. The atmega48, atmega88 and atmega168 differ only in memory sizes, boot loader. The arduino nano is a small, complete, and breadboard. The arduino pro is a microcontroller board based on the atmega168 datasheet or atmega328 datasheet. Pure storage flasharrayx, the worlds first 100% allflash endtoend nvme and nvmeof array, now optionally includes a storage class memory boost to address the most demanding enterprise applications performance requirements. The atmega1280 and atmega2560, with more pinout and memory. Data is your organizations most valuable asset, but slow and complex legacy storage systems often make it hard to put it to use.
Using serial peripheral interface spi master and slave. Of course this can be found in the atmega168 datasheet from atmel but sometimes it is also handy to know which arduino pins correspond to the atmega168 pin numbers. The current consumption is a function of several factors. First digit of the datecode being z ork identifiessilicon characterized in this datasheet type vdss rdson id irf740 400 v pdf, datasheet, pdf datasheet, ic, chip, semiconductor. The ptc is supported by the qtouch composer development tool qtouch library project builder and qtouch analyzer. Atmega16820pu datasheet atmel, download pdf radiolocman. A comprehensive set of development tools, application notes and datasheets are. The arduino nano is a compact board similar to the uno.
Microcontroller with 8k bytes insystem programmable flash. Atmega328 pdf high performance, low power atmelavr 8bit microcontroller family. The arduino nano can be programmed with the arduino software. Atmega168 15md datasheet, atmega168 15md pdf, atmega168 15md data sheet, atmega168 15md manual, atmega168 15md pdf, atmega168 15md, datenblatt, electronics atmega168. It lacks only a dc power jack, and works with a minib usb cable instead of a. Use oneclick automation and selfservice for provisioning and data protection. Atmega168 datasheet, atmega168 pdf, atmega168 data sheet, datasheet, data sheet, pdf, atmel, 16k byte selfprogramming flash program memory. Hybrid storage with bestinclass data management and cloud integration designed to support more of your it needs, the netapp fas2600 hybrid storage arrays provide more value than other systems in their class.
Data sheet pure storage flashblade experience scaleout storage for modern data. The act of programming a single page of flash is actually threestep procedure. In this article,we will cover most interesting parts og the datasheet related to. Exposure to absolute maximum rating conditions for extended periods may affect device reliability. Ic avr mcu 16k 10mhz 28dip online from elcodis, view and download atmega168v10pu pdf datasheet, embedded microcontrollers specifications. Atmega168 datasheet pdf 16k byte selfprogramming flash. Table 1 summarizes the different memory and interrupt vector sizes for the three devices. Data sheet complete ds40002074apage 2 six pwm channels 8channel 10bit adc in tqfp and qfnmlf package. When this line is asserted taken low, the reset line drops long.
Overview the atmega16 is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ture. All it means is that you have 8k storage locations, each location being 16bits wide. Ic avr mcu 16k 20mhz 32tqfp online from elcodis, view and download atmega168 20au pdf datasheet, embedded microcontrollers specifications. The a000005 is an arduino nanoboard which is a small, breadboardfriendly board based on the atmega328 arduino nano 3. It accepts four bcd inputs 0a to 3a and provides ten mutually exclusive outputs 0y to 9y. Just to reiterate, since you were asking questions on another thread. Atmega16820aur microchip technology atmel mouser united. Atmega 8bit avr microcontroller datasheet microchip technology. Atmega88 and atmega168 support a real readwhilewrite selfprogramming mechanism. Atmega16820pu microchip technology atmel mouser europe. Atmega328 datasheet, atmega328 pdf, atmega328 data sheet, atmega328 manual, atmega328 pdf, atmega328, datenblatt, electronics atmega328, alldatasheet, free, datasheet. Timers give us an extra level of control by giving us not only control over what happens but when it happens. These are modified harvard architecture 8bit risc singlechip microcontrollers.
A brief tutorial on programming the atmega arduino. A bit from a register in the register file can be copied into t by the bst instruction, and a bit in t can be copied into a bit in a register in the register file by the bld instruction. Atmega88 atmega168 automotive datasheet 3 9365aavr0216 1. A brief tutorial on programming the atmega arduino without arduino software this series of tutorials cover programming of many features of the atmega chip using the c programming language. The arduino nano is a small, complete, and breadboardfriendly board based on the atmega328 arduino nano. The arduino nano is a small, complete, and breadboardfriendly board based on the atmega328p arduino nano 3. The atmel atmega88 and atmega168 differ only in memory sizes, boot loader support, and interrupt vector sizes. Description the atmel avr core combines a rich instruction set with 32 general purpose working registers.
Mplab x integrated development environment ide mplabxide mplab x integrated development environment ide is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of microchips microcontrollers, microprocessors and digital signal controllers. Pdf we will present the details on the introduction to atmega168.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a battery power jack, a. We have seen in previous chapters how we could take in an input, perform mathematical functions on the data and, perform an action. Second, the new page data needs to be loaded into a special temporary hardware buffer one word at a time. Empowered by realtime system information about each block of data, storage center optimizes data placement, management and protection.
Compare pricing for microchip atmega168 20au across 36 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. Microcontroller with 4816 32k bytes insystem programmable flash atmega48pv atmega88pv atmega168pv atmega328p preliminary not recommended for new designs. Atmega168 pdf, atmega168 description, atmega168 datasheets. The atmel atmega88 and atmega168 differ only in memory sizes, boot loader support, and interrupt. Microcontroller with 481632k bytes insystem programmable. I suggest that you walk through the atmega168 datasheets description of bootloader support first. Atmega168 20pu microchip technology atmel 8bit microcontrollers mcu 16kb flash 0. Data sheet pure storage flasharrayx accelerate core applications and provide a modern data experience. Download pdf 256k view the full article as a pdf storage center leverages a patented fluid data architecture that changes the way organizations manage data. Pdf fs2009 rs232 4831018nd led project using avr projects of led with program atmega 32 avr datasheet usb atmega 24xxx eeprom programmer avr projects avr isp programmer port advantages of microcontroller avr atmega oscillator calibration simple eeprom programmer usb.
Memory the atmega32u4 has 32 kb with, control boards processor for additional storage. In addition, the atmega4888168 features an eeprom memory for data storage. By executing powerful instructions in a single clock cycle, the atmega4888168 achieves throughputs approaching 1 mips per mhz allowing the system designer to optimize power consumption versus processing speed. Atmega168 20au microchip technology atmel 8bit microcontrollers mcu 16kb flash 0. The device supports a throughput of 20 mips at 20mhz and operates between 2. Atmels highdensity nonvolatile memory technology and is compatible with the indus trystandard 80c51 instruction set and pinout. You dont really have to interpret 8k x 16 to mean multiply by 16. Apr 06, 2020 atmega168 contains 16k bytes of code flash memory where your program will be stored. The atmega8 and the atmega88168328 are backwards compatible when it comes to the pinouts however, they are programmed slightly different and while external interrupts work the same way on both types of micro controllers they do require different code to run. Because once it is placed in an application programmer and connectors are basically useless. Download atmega328 datasheet some people also search for atmega 328p datasheet with following words, current datasheet serves for all of these queries.
Atmel atmega88168 automotive appendix a atmel atmega88168 automotive. It has more or less the same functionality of the arduino duemilanove, but in a different package. Avr was one of the first microcontroller families to use onchip flash memory. Pdf introduction to atmega168 used in many applications. Peripheral features two 8bit timercounters with separate prescaler and compare mode one 16bit timercounter with separate prescaler, compare mode, and capture mode. Description 8bit microcontroller with 8k bytes insystem programmable flash. High precision capacitive type full range temperature compensated relative humidity and temperature measurement c alibrated digital signal o utstanding longterm stability e xtra components not needed l ong transmission distance, up to 100 meters. The program memory is 16k, based on flash, and incorporates readwrite. Atmega16820au microchip datasheet and cad model download. By executing powerful instructions in a single clock cycle, the atmega16 achieves throughputs approaching 1 mips per mhz allowing the system designer to optimize power consumption versus processing speed. The atmega168 20pu is a 8bit highperformance, lowpower avr riscbased microcontroller unit combines 16kb isp flash memory, 1kb sram, 512b eeprom, an 8channel10bit ad converter tqfp and qfnmlf and debugwire for onchip debugging.
You dont actually need a menu item for the chip you want to use, you can just edit your preferences file and set build. The atmega48, atmega88 and atmega168 differ only in memory sizes. Atmel 8bit microcontroller with 8k bytes insystem programmable flash,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. C compilers, macro assemblers, program debuggersimulators, incircuit emu lators, and evaluation kits. All the 32 registers are directly connected to the arithmetic logic unit alu, allowing two independent registers. Atmega328 pdf atmega328 pdf atmega328 pdf download.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ors.
The highperformance, lowpower microchip avr riscbased cmos 8bit microcontroller combines 16kb isp flash memory with readwhilewrite capabilities, 512b eeprom, 1kb sram, 23 general purpose io lines, 32 general purpose working registers, three flexible timercounters with compare modes, internal and external interrupts, serial programmable. You dont need to worry about the ide at least, not at first. Netapp data sheet netapp fas2600 series hybrid storage. It has similar functionality to the arduino duemilanove, but in a different package. Arduino pro mini pin diagram, technical specifications. Onchip isp flash allows the program memory to be reprogrammed. Download atmega16820pu datasheet pdf atmel document. Import luns from thirdparty storage arrays directly into an aff system to seamlessly migrate data. Atmega16820ai atmel datasheet and cad model download octopart.
The logic design ensures that all outputs are high when binary codes greater than nine are applied to the inputs. The nano was designed and is being produced by gravitech. Atmega16820mu microchip technology atmel mouser europe. Since it is an application board it does not have inbuilt programmer. Atmega48a, atmega48pa, atmega88a, atmega88pa, atmega168a. Atmel 8bit microcontroller with 8k bytes insystem programmable flash,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ors. Readynas 420 series network attached storage nas data. The atmega168 has 16 kb of flash memory for storing code of which 2 kb is used for the bootloader. Atmel 8bit microcontroller with 4816k bytes insystem programmable flash,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its. Atmega168 20mu microchip technology atmel 8bit microcontrollers mcu 16kb flash 0. If more the one spi devices is connected to the same bus, then we need four ports and use the fourth port ss pin on the atmega168 microcontroller to select the target spi device before starting to communicate with it. The atmel atmega4888168 is a lowpower cmos 8bit microcontroller based on the avr enhanced risc architecture.
Typical values contained in this datasheet are based on simulations and. Bit copy storage the bit copy instructions bld bit load and bst bit store use the tbit as source or destination for the operated bit. Table 21 summarizes the different memory and interrupt vector sizes for the three devices. Atmega16820ai atmel datasheet and cad model download. The port e pins are tristated when a reset condition becomes active, even if the clock is not running.
964 497 1011 953 119 1651 197 1511 917 177 1587 1082 718 632 1261 1378 514 832 753 992 1533 1186 968 1075 908 1125 909 798 641 1486 1007 712 125 229 1587 526 447 1179 684 222 1270 1244 262 1377 692